A POWERHOUSE PERFORMANCE

Imelda Staunton is simply unstoppable as Mama Rose. The supporting cast are bright and energetic but the star brings the house down. A must see for all theatre fans.

3 HOURS OF MY LIFE...

3 hours of my life I will never get back. This is quite possibly the worst thing I've ever seen at the theatre. If we weren't with my husband's parents we'd have left at the interval. It is just so dated. The irony is that the audience has to repeatedly suffer the terrible act that the story revolves around . It's mildly amusing the first time around but the annoying, shrill voices are like someone running their nails down a blackboard. Given the amazing reviews, we couldn't have been more disappointed. Even the staging was poor. As dated as the show itself. I appreciate this show is typical of its era, but we've moved on and this show needs to be consigned to the archives. You can put the best cast in the world on the stage, but if the material is this bad there's only so much they can do. Why others in the audience gave it a standing ovation baffles me.
